First things first, for those that don't know: CoH: Mission Planner
This is a handy application that allows you to edit AE missions offline. The biggest use is to get the bulk of your text in place or to copy and paste objectives (at least for me anyway). Huge kudos to the author!
The problem is, the last update was in April and although the project says it's not dead, the delay is due to a lapsed game account. I would love to see this project brought back, updated, and continued with new features... but my hopes in the matter are fading.
So now I'm asking the public if there is an alternative. An offline editor that helps with my text, mission objectives, and maybe even map pictures. If there is an active project in alpha or beta, I will gladly help with testing or information gathering (sorry, I'm not a coder unless you're working with BASIC).
I feel that AE has a lot of untapped potential in part due to the in-game editor being a bit intimidating for some players. Not being able to copy and paste or color text easy can become frustrating when you just want to get your story out there. I'm hoping there are more efforts on the offline AE mission front, or maybe even ones I've simply missed.

Best I can tell, Xs in the legend are placed as Os on the map and vice versa. The only map I can 100% confirm this for is the Hellion building arson since I've been working with it a lot recently.
Also, the spawn locations (front, middle, and back) don't seem to always follow the rules. For a while, I was convinced that only wall placement items were showing up as such: Front = Front, Middle = Back, Back = Middle. As I was doing my last test before a map server disconnect, my boss character who had been very good about spawning at the back of the map like she should, spawned in the middle with no editing between attempts. When I checked to see what might have spawned in her spot, it was empty. Again, for the same map I mentioned before.
I love MA. Really love the new additions. But boy is it a test of wills at times. -
